ブログ向けレンタルサーバー

レンタルサーバーのセキュリティ対策はどこまで必要?初心者向け徹底解説

レンタルサーバーのセキュリティ対策はどこまで必要?初心者向け徹底解説 ブログ向けレンタルサーバー

初めてブログを始める方にとって、レンタルサーバーのセキュリティ対策は少し難しく感じるかもしれません。しかし、セキュリティ対策を怠ると、大切なブログが改ざんされたり、情報が漏洩したりするリスクがあります。この記事では、初心者の方でも理解しやすいように、レンタルサーバーのセキュリティ対策の重要性から、具体的な対策方法、有料サービスの検討ポイントまでを徹底的に解説します。安心してブログ運営を始めるために、ぜひ参考にしてください。

レンタルサーバー選びの重要ポイント:セキュリティ面

レンタルサーバーを選ぶ際、価格や機能だけでなく、セキュリティ面も非常に重要なポイントです。セキュリティ対策が不十分なサーバーを選んでしまうと、様々なリスクにさらされる可能性があります。ここでは、レンタルサーバー選びで特に注目すべきセキュリティのポイントについて解説します。

サーバーのセキュリティ機能を確認する

レンタルサーバーが提供しているセキュリティ機能は、サーバーによって大きく異なります。
例えば、WAF(Web Application Firewall)の有無、不正アクセス検知機能、自動バックアップ機能などが挙げられます。これらの機能が充実しているほど、セキュリティリスクを軽減することができます。各サーバーの公式サイトや資料をよく確認し、必要な機能が備わっているかを確認しましょう。

SSL/TLS証明書の提供状況をチェックする

SSL/TLS証明書は、ウェブサイトと訪問者の間の通信を暗号化し、データの盗聴や改ざんを防ぐためのものです。近年では、SSL/TLS証明書はウェブサイトの信頼性を示す指標ともなっており、SEOにも影響を与えると言われています。多くのレンタルサーバーでは、無料でSSL/TLS証明書を提供していますが、一部有料の場合や、設定方法が難しい場合もあります。必ずSSL/TLS証明書の提供状況と設定方法を確認しましょう。

サーバーの稼働状況とセキュリティアップデートの頻度を見る

サーバーの安定稼働は、セキュリティ面でも重要です。サーバーが頻繁に停止したり、不安定な状態が続いたりすると、セキュリティホールが放置されたり、不正アクセスに気づきにくくなったりする可能性があります。また、OSやミドルウェアのセキュリティアップデートは、最新の脅威からサーバーを守るために不可欠です。レンタルサーバーの公式サイトやサポート情報を確認し、サーバーの稼働状況やセキュリティアップデートの頻度を確認しましょう。

提供会社のセキュリティ対策への取り組み姿勢を知る

レンタルサーバー提供会社のセキュリティ対策への取り組み姿勢も重要な判断材料です。
例えば、情報セキュリティに関する国際規格であるISO27001認証を取得しているか、セキュリティ専門チームを設置しているか、定期的にセキュリティ診断を実施しているかなどを確認しましょう。これらの情報は、提供会社の信頼性を示すとともに、セキュリティ対策に対する意識の高さを知る手がかりとなります。

必須セキュリティ対策:初心者でもできること

レンタルサーバーを契約したら、すぐにセキュリティ対策に取り組みましょう。ここでは、初心者の方でも簡単にできる、必須のセキュリティ対策について解説します。

強力なパスワードを設定する

パスワードは、アカウントを守るための最も基本的なセキュリティ対策です。
推測されやすいパスワード(誕生日、名前、電話番号など)や、他のサービスで使い回しているパスワードは絶対に避けましょう。パスワードは、英数字、記号を組み合わせた12文字以上の複雑なものを使用し、定期的に変更するようにしましょう。パスワード管理ツールなどを活用するのも有効です。

不要なファイルやプログラムを削除する

レンタルサーバーにインストールされている不要なファイルやプログラムは、セキュリティリスクを高める可能性があります。
例えば、古いバージョンのCMSや、使用していないプラグインなどは、脆弱性が発見された場合に攻撃の対象となる可能性があります。不要なファイルやプログラムは、速やかに削除するようにしましょう。

アクセス制限を設定する

レンタルサーバーへのアクセスを制限することで、不正アクセスを防ぐことができます。
例えば、特定のIPアドレスからのアクセスのみを許可したり、特定のファイルやディレクトリへのアクセスを制限したりすることができます。レンタルサーバーのコントロールパネルや、.htaccessファイルなどを利用して、アクセス制限を設定しましょう。

定期的にバックアップを取得する

万が一、サーバーが攻撃を受けたり、データが破損したりした場合に備えて、定期的にバックアップを取得しておくことが重要です。
多くのレンタルサーバーでは、自動バックアップ機能を提供していますが、手動でバックアップを取得することも可能です。バックアップデータは、サーバーとは別の場所に保管するようにしましょう。

レンタルサーバーの提供するセキュリティツールを利用する

多くのレンタルサーバーでは、セキュリティ対策を支援するためのツールを提供しています。
例えば、WAF(Web Application Firewall)や、不正アクセス検知ツールなどがあります。これらのツールを活用することで、専門的な知識がなくても、ある程度のセキュリティ対策を講じることができます。レンタルサーバーが提供するセキュリティツールを積極的に利用しましょう。
例えば、エックスサーバーでは、「SiteGuard Lite」というWAFを無料で提供しており、不正なアクセスを自動的に防御してくれます。また、ConoHa WINGでは、「WAF」機能や「不正ログイン防御」機能などを提供しており、Webサイトのセキュリティを強化できます。

WordPress利用時のセキュリティ強化策

WordPressは、世界中で最も利用されているCMSの一つですが、その人気ゆえに、攻撃の対象となりやすい側面もあります。WordPressを利用する際は、レンタルサーバーのセキュリティ対策に加えて、WordPress固有のセキュリティ対策を講じることが重要です。

WordPress本体、テーマ、プラグインを常に最新の状態に保つ

WordPress本体、テーマ、プラグインには、脆弱性が発見されることがあります。
これらの脆弱性を放置すると、攻撃者によって悪用される可能性があります。WordPress本体、テーマ、プラグインは、常に最新の状態に保つようにしましょう。アップデートは、管理画面から簡単に行うことができます。

信頼できるテーマ、プラグインのみを利用する

WordPressのテーマやプラグインは、公式ディレクトリからダウンロードするのが基本ですが、中には悪意のあるコードが埋め込まれているものも存在します。信頼できないテーマやプラグインを利用すると、セキュリティリスクを高める可能性があります。テーマやプラグインは、できる限り公式ディレクトリからダウンロードし、レビューや評価をよく確認してから利用するようにしましょう。

セキュリティプラグインを導入する

WordPressのセキュリティを強化するために、専用のセキュリティプラグインを導入することを検討しましょう。
例えば、「Wordfence Security」、「All In One WP Security & Firewall」、「Sucuri Security」などがあります。これらのプラグインは、不正アクセス検知、ファイアウォール、マルウェアスキャンなどの機能を提供し、WordPressのセキュリティを大幅に向上させることができます。

ログインURLを変更する

WordPressのデフォルトのログインURL(/wp-admin/や/wp-login.php)は、攻撃者にとって格好の標的となります。
ログインURLを変更することで、ブルートフォースアタック(総当たり攻撃)のリスクを軽減することができます。「Edit Login Page」などのプラグインを利用すると、簡単にログインURLを変更することができます。

不要なトラックバック、ピンバックを無効にする

トラックバックやピンバックは、他のサイトから自分のサイトへのリンクを通知する機能ですが、悪用されるとスパムコメントの温床となる可能性があります。
不要なトラックバックやピンバックは無効にすることで、セキュリティリスクを軽減することができます。WordPressの設定画面から、簡単に無効にすることができます。

有料セキュリティサービスは必要?検討ポイント

レンタルサーバーやWordPressのセキュリティ対策は、無料の範囲でも十分に行うことができますが、より高度なセキュリティ対策を求める場合は、有料のセキュリティサービスを検討するのも一つの選択肢です。ここでは、有料セキュリティサービスを検討する際のポイントについて解説します。

無料の対策でどこまでできるかを把握する

有料セキュリティサービスを検討する前に、まず無料の対策でどこまでできるかを把握しましょう。
この記事で紹介したような対策をしっかりと行えば、ある程度のセキュリティリスクは軽減することができます。無料の対策で十分な場合もありますので、まずは無料の対策を徹底的に行いましょう。

有料サービスで何が強化されるかを理解する

有料セキュリティサービスは、無料の対策では難しい高度なセキュリティ機能を提供します。
例えば、専門家によるセキュリティ診断、マルウェア駆除サービス、DDoS攻撃対策などがあります。有料サービスで何が強化されるかを理解し、自分のサイトに必要な機能を見極めることが重要です。

費用対効果を考慮する

有料セキュリティサービスは、当然ながら費用がかかります。
費用対効果を考慮し、自分のサイトの規模や重要度、予算などを考慮して、有料サービスを導入するかどうかを検討しましょう。高額なサービスが必ずしも最適とは限りません。

サービスの信頼性を確認する

有料セキュリティサービスを提供する会社は多数存在しますが、中には信頼できない業者も存在します。
サービスの信頼性を確認するために、実績、評判、サポート体制などをよく確認しましょう。第三者機関による評価や、利用者のレビューなどを参考にするのも有効です。

具体的な有料セキュリティサービス例

有料セキュリティサービスには、様々な種類があります。以下に、代表的なサービス例をいくつか紹介します。

Cloudflare

Cloudflareは、世界的に有名なCDN(コンテンツデリバリーネットワーク)プロバイダーですが、セキュリティ機能も充実しています。DDoS攻撃対策、WAF、ボット防御などの機能を提供しており、Webサイトのパフォーマンス向上とセキュリティ強化を同時に実現できます。無料プランもありますが、より高度なセキュリティ機能を求める場合は、有料プランを検討しましょう。

Sucuri

Sucuriは、Webサイトセキュリティに特化したサービスを提供しています。マルウェアスキャン、マルウェア駆除、ファイアウォールなどの機能を提供しており、Webサイトを徹底的に保護することができます。専門家によるマルウェア駆除サービスも提供しており、万が一、感染してしまった場合でも安心です。

SiteLock

SiteLockは、Webサイトの脆弱性スキャン、マルウェアスキャン、ファイアウォールなどの機能を提供しています。脆弱性スキャンによって、Webサイトのセキュリティホールを特定し、修正することができます。また、マルウェアスキャンによって、Webサイトに感染したマルウェアを検出し、駆除することができます。

定期的なセキュリティチェックで安全性を維持

セキュリティ対策は、一度行えば終わりではありません。
時間とともに新たな脆弱性が発見されたり、攻撃手法が進化したりするため、定期的にセキュリティチェックを行い、安全性を維持する必要があります。

セキュリティ関連の情報を収集する

セキュリティに関する情報は、常に変化しています。
最新のセキュリティニュースや、脆弱性情報を収集し、自分のサイトに影響がないかを確認しましょう。セキュリティ関連のブログやニュースサイトを購読したり、SNSでセキュリティ専門家をフォローしたりするのも有効です。

定期的に脆弱性スキャンを実施する

Webサイトやサーバーに脆弱性がないか、定期的にスキャンを実施しましょう。
脆弱性スキャンツールを利用すると、自動的に脆弱性を検出することができます。有料の脆弱性スキャンツールもありますが、無料のツールでも十分な場合もあります。例えば、OWASP ZAPなどのオープンソースの脆弱性スキャンツールを利用することができます。

アクセスログを監視する

アクセスログを監視することで、不正なアクセスや攻撃の兆候を早期に発見することができます。
アクセスログ分析ツールを利用すると、アクセス状況を可視化し、異常なアクセスを検出しやすくなります。例えば、Google Analyticsなどのアクセス解析ツールを利用して、アクセス状況を監視することができます。

WordPressのセキュリティ診断サービスを利用する

WordPressのセキュリティに不安がある場合は、専門家によるセキュリティ診断サービスを利用することを検討しましょう。
セキュリティ専門家は、専門的な知識と経験に基づいて、WordPressのセキュリティ状況を診断し、改善策を提案してくれます。

まとめ

レンタルサーバーのセキュリティ対策は、ブログ運営において非常に重要な要素です。
この記事では、レンタルサーバー選びのポイントから、初心者でもできる具体的な対策、有料サービスの検討ポイント、定期的なセキュリティチェックまでを解説しました。

セキュリティ対策は、決して難しいものではありません。
基本的な対策をしっかりと行い、定期的にセキュリティチェックを行うことで、大切なブログを安全に運営することができます。

ぜひこの記事を参考にして、あなたのブログのセキュリティ対策を見直し、安心してブログ運営を楽しんでください。

投稿者プロフィール

ヒガナカ編集部
ヒガナカ編集部
タイトルとURLをコピーしました